This book covers all aspects of toxicology, including toxic diseases of large animals, small animals, and exotic pets. It provides key information on how poisons affect the body, how the body responds to a foreign substance, how poisonings are diagnosed, and how poisonings are treated. Coverage includes every organ system of every species of animal with details on each body system's susceptibility to poison. Poisons affect animals differently depending on species, breed, age, gender, health status, and reproductive status. This resource addresses these differences, allowing the veterinarian to determine the class of toxicant, the mechanism of action, and the proper course of treatment. If confronted with an unknown poison, the information in this book will assist the veterinarian in formulating a list of potential poisons based on the clinical signs that the animal is exhibiting, and in choosing the appropriate tests to narrow the list to one or a few possible poisons. Part One: Principles of Toxicology -- 1. Concepts and Terminology -- 2. Toxicokinetics -- 3. Treatment -- 4. Diagnostic Toxicology -- 5. Regulatory Toxicology -- Part Two: Manifestations of Toxicoses -- 6. Cardiovascular System -- 7. Dermal System -- 8. Endocrine System -- 9. Gastrointestinal System -- 10. Hematic System -- 11. Hepatobiliary System -- 12. Musculoskeletal System -- 13. Nervous System -- 14. Renal System -- 15. Reproductive System -- 16. Respiratory System -- 17. Sudden Death -- Part Three: Classes of Toxicants -- 18. Biotoxins -- 19. Feed-Associated Toxicants -- 20. Household and Industrial Products -- 21. Insecticides and Molluscicides -- 22. Metals and Minerals -- 23. Mycotoxins -- 24. Pharmaceuticals -- 25. Plants -- 26. Rodenticides and Avicides.
